)]}'
{"kayobe/ansible.py":[{"author":{"_account_id":14826,"name":"Mark Goddard","email":"markgoddard86@gmail.com","username":"mgoddard"},"change_message_id":"5f356a276efbaae1f7ad588777500f783666163c","unresolved":true,"context_lines":[{"line_number":98,"context_line":"                inventories.append(shared_inventory)"},{"line_number":99,"context_line":"            env_inventory \u003d os.path.join(env_path, \"inventory\")"},{"line_number":100,"context_line":"            if os.path.exists(env_inventory):"},{"line_number":101,"context_line":"                inventories.append(env_inventory)"},{"line_number":102,"context_line":"        else:"},{"line_number":103,"context_line":"            # Preserve existing behaviour: don\u0027t check if an inventory"},{"line_number":104,"context_line":"            # directory exists when no environment is specified"}],"source_content_type":"text/x-python","patch_set":1,"id":"df4614f7_7b73a020","line":101,"updated":"2021-02-02 17:04:44.000000000","message":"Does this mean that the env inventory takes precedence over the shared one where there is a conflict?","commit_id":"772f85e376450004386d82d8106e12971148147d"},{"author":{"_account_id":15197,"name":"Pierre Riteau","email":"pierre@stackhpc.com","username":"priteau","status":"StackHPC"},"change_message_id":"ce7acd30c8f8ddb6af5b559fd7967865558bb1ed","unresolved":true,"context_lines":[{"line_number":98,"context_line":"                inventories.append(shared_inventory)"},{"line_number":99,"context_line":"            env_inventory \u003d os.path.join(env_path, \"inventory\")"},{"line_number":100,"context_line":"            if os.path.exists(env_inventory):"},{"line_number":101,"context_line":"                inventories.append(env_inventory)"},{"line_number":102,"context_line":"        else:"},{"line_number":103,"context_line":"            # Preserve existing behaviour: don\u0027t check if an inventory"},{"line_number":104,"context_line":"            # directory exists when no environment is specified"}],"source_content_type":"text/x-python","patch_set":1,"id":"f0b3e782_f455c38b","line":101,"in_reply_to":"df4614f7_7b73a020","updated":"2021-02-02 20:53:07.000000000","message":"I assume so, although I have not tested this yet. This would be the expected behaviour given how env extra vars override shared ones.","commit_id":"772f85e376450004386d82d8106e12971148147d"},{"author":{"_account_id":14826,"name":"Mark Goddard","email":"markgoddard86@gmail.com","username":"mgoddard"},"change_message_id":"29ebe61cb8985dc67c4f4ecfec614e32e3d574ec","unresolved":true,"context_lines":[{"line_number":98,"context_line":"                inventories.append(shared_inventory)"},{"line_number":99,"context_line":"            env_inventory \u003d os.path.join(env_path, \"inventory\")"},{"line_number":100,"context_line":"            if os.path.exists(env_inventory):"},{"line_number":101,"context_line":"                inventories.append(env_inventory)"},{"line_number":102,"context_line":"        else:"},{"line_number":103,"context_line":"            # Preserve existing behaviour: don\u0027t check if an inventory"},{"line_number":104,"context_line":"            # directory exists when no environment is specified"}],"source_content_type":"text/x-python","patch_set":1,"id":"b3023d3c_ed921b1d","line":101,"in_reply_to":"f0b3e782_f455c38b","updated":"2021-03-10 12:21:55.000000000","message":"Tested. Later inventory arguments take precedence. So this should work as expected.","commit_id":"772f85e376450004386d82d8106e12971148147d"}]}
